Characterisation of photoalignment materials for photonic applications at visible and infrared wavelengths

2005

Abstract

In this paper we discuss the processing and characterisation. of Linearly Polymerisable Polymers to align Liquid Crystal Prepolymers for use in photonic application. Preliminary results on uniform retardation waveplates for use in free space optics are given.
